EXCLUSIVE! Rishi Kapoor’s Last Film ‘Sharmaji Namkeen’ To Release In Theatres On This Date

There is some good news for Rishi Kapoor's fans as his last film titled ‘Sharmaji Namkeen’ will be released in theatres this year. Read on to know full details.

New Delhi: Bollywood actor Rishi Kapoor passed away last year leaving everyone teary-eyed. He breathed his last on April 30, 2020. During his lifetime, the ‘Chandni’ actor has received many awards and accolades for his contribution to the Hindi film industry. He also left some of his remarkable works on-screen for his fans to enjoy.

After his death, his fans were left heartbroken about the fact they will not be able to watch the legendary actor spill his magic on-screen. However, there is some good news for his fans as the last film of Rishi Kapoor titled ‘Sharmaji Namkeen’ will be released in theatres this year. Though the shoot of the movie is still -pending, the makers endeavour to present the veteran actor’s last film as a tribute to his fans and him. The film is slated to release on Rishi Kapoor’s birthday this year on September 4.

To achieve this reality, Paresh Rawal has agreed to complete the remaining part of the film in the same role - a sensitive step that is unprecedented in Hindi cinema. The filmmakers and Paresh Rawal have taken this decision in order to release the film as a mark of respect for the legendary actor Rishi Kapoor.

Produced by Ritesh Sidhwani & Farhan Akhtar in association with MacGuffin Pictures, ‘Sharmaji Namkeen’ has been directed by debutante Hitesh Bhatia. This film is a light-hearted coming-of-age story of a lovable 60-year-old man. The makers and team of ‘Sharmaji Namkeen’ are ready to resume shoot soon with plans of a 2021 release.
